Output c99bbabb68a8f7150b743e1919bda132a9d77c2c4d8c91795fd04d13eb11f238:58

value
104682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da7f33a60328135887194079fc546346a1fb8b9 OP_EQUAL
address
3Mu2TKJqDECtVJzwCZgPbjXeS7aBWuh5Rk
transaction
c99bbabb68a8f7150b743e1919bda132a9d77c2c4d8c91795fd04d13eb11f238
spent
true